MEMO — Finance Team

Hi all, quick one from the Pellerow Systems ops side. We're asking for an extra 40k this quarter to cover the tooling upgrade on the Marviton line. The old rig keeps stalling and the maintenance bills are eating us alive. Dara ran the numbers and payback lands inside eight months, which is better than most of our recent asks. Full breakdown is attached. Before you sign off, please read the note below.

confidential, kagup-bafog: Fraaxax Group is in early talks to buy Soroxox Group for about $343.8 million. The Olidor launch date is June 14, and nothing goes to the press before then. Legal wants the Aldmirek Logistics term sheet signed before July 23.

## Releases

Hey support folks — quick notes on ProfileMesh shard releases. Each release re-balances user-profile shards gradually, so don't panic if a lookup lands on a stale shard for a few minutes post-deploy; it self-heals. Release bundles are published twice a month and are always signed. If a customer asks you to verify a bundle they downloaded, walk them through the checksum step using the public signing key below.

deploy key for kawif-bageg: bky19_YQNdHDgpaLxUNwPoHm9

Subject: Partner SFTP drop — new owner

Hi,

As you review the pending changes to the Harborline ingest scripts, note that ownership of the partner SFTP drop is changing at the end of the month. This includes key rotation, the nightly pull job, and the quarantine folder for malformed files. Review comments on the retry logic should still go through the normal PR flow, but questions about drop-folder conventions or partner onboarding now go to the new owner. The incoming owner is listed below.

signatory, tagaf-bahaf: Praael Fenmir Rusok

Subject: Gatewing cut-over done

Team — the Gatewing gateway now enforces per-client rate limits at the edge instead of in each service. Old token-bucket shims are removed. If a client sees 429s, check their tier before escalating. Rollback window closed Friday. New joiners: read the limits doc before touching quotas. The active config values are as follows.

settings of fafog-haduf:
ZORIX_PIN=4648
ZORIX_METRICS_HOST=metrics.zorix.paliqsys.corp
ZORIX_LOG_LEVEL=info
ZORIX_TENANT=druix